Bahrain Reaffirms Humanitarian Commitment in Gaza Relief Efforts
The Royal Humanitarian Foundation has highlighted Bahrain’s ongoing humanitarian initiatives in Gaza during a meeting between Acting Secretary-General Eng. Ebrahim Dallal Al Dossary and Bahrain’s Ambassador to Egypt and Permanent Representative to the Arab League, H.E. Fawzia bint Abdullah Zainal.
The discussions focused on Bahrain’s relief and development projects in the Gaza Strip, including the Bahrain Hospital, Bahrain Schools, and recent emergency aid shipments delivered to support affected civilians.
Al Dossary reaffirmed the Foundation’s commitment to continuing humanitarian and development efforts beyond Bahrain, stressing that such initiatives strengthen the Kingdom’s global humanitarian presence.
He also expressed appreciation to the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, led by Dr. Abdullatif bin Rashid Al Zayani, for its continued support in facilitating overseas aid operations and ensuring efficient delivery of assistance to those in need.
Separately, the Foundation commended the United Arab Emirates for its humanitarian role in “Operation Gallant Knight 3,” which aims to support relief efforts in Gaza through coordinated international assistance.
